The Pimento pepper is a variety of chilli pepper with almost no heat (more on that below). From the nightshade family, their scientific name is Capsicum annuum. Pimentos can be used in cooking as an ingredient, spice, or garnish. Known commonly as Pimento peppers, you will also see it spelled "Pimiento.".

Around the same time Spain began exporting canned peppers, or pimiento, to the United States. The first recipe combining these two ingredients was published in Good Housekeeping in 1908 and combined cream cheese, pimientos, mustard, and chives. The recipe became so popular that it started to be mass produced, especially in the south.

A decidedly Southern spread with Northern roots, pimento cheese is a simple mix of Cheddar, red bell pepper and mayonnaise that can be found on sandwiches or served as a spread for crackers from work sites to garden parties across the 16 states below the Mason-Dixon line This recipe came to The Times from the Charleston, S.C.-bred cookbook authors Matt Lee and Ted Lee.

Spicy Pimento Dip. If you want to make your pimento cheese dip spicy, add 1-2 teaspoons of seeded and diced jalapenos. If you don't want to mess around with chopping peppers, add 1 teaspoon of crushed red pepper flakes. For best results, allow your dip to sit and the spicy flavors to marry and sink into the cream cheese and mayonnaise.

Pimentos, also referred to as pimientos, are a type of pepper with a sweet flavor and very little heat. This nightshade is also known as a cherry pepper because of its red color and round, heart-shaped fruit. They usually measure about 3 to 4 inches long and 2 to 3 inches wide, with a short, thick green stem.
